Description

The Administration on Disabilities (AoD) seeks to fund one (1) five-year grant to create an Alternatives to Guardianship Youth Resource Center. Research shows the majority (57 percent) of people with ID/DD ages 18 to 22 receiving publicly funded services have guardians.The Center will work to divert high school students with ID/DD away from guardianship to less restrictive decisional supports. The target audience for this information includes youth with ID/DD, parents and caregivers of high school students with I/DD, special education teachers, education administrators, advocates, vocational rehabilitation counselors, guidance counselors, and school district officials. As a result of funding this Center, AoD expects that:1. More students with I/DD will have more decisional options, such as Powers of Attorney, supported-decision-making (SDM), joint bank accounts, bill paying services, and medical or educational release forms, on completion of high school;2. Fewer young adults with I/DD will be subject to guardianship;3. The public will become more knowledgeable of alternatives to guardianship; and4. Youth will become more independent by gaining job experience and personal responsibilities.

Who can apply

  • Independent school districts
  • Public and State controlled institutions of higher education
  • Native American tribal organizations (other than Federally recognized)
  • Nonprofits with 501(c)(3) status (other than higher education)
  • Nonprofits without 501(c)(3) status (other than higher education)
  • Private institutions of higher education

Key dates & funding
  • PostedApr 30, 2020
  • ClosesJun 29, 2020
  • Award floor$250,000
  • Award ceiling$300,000
  • Program funding$1,500,000
  • Expected awards1
  • CFDA93.631
